The Germany Hybrid Valve Market is witnessing significant growth, driven by rising demand for advanced valve solutions across key sectors such as oil & gas, water & wastewater, and energy & power. Hybrid valves, which combine features of multiple valve types, provide enhanced reliability, reduced leakage, and lower maintenance costs. The market is being propelled by rapid industrial automation, increasing focus on energy efficiency, and stringent environmental regulations. Advancements in valve technology and digital integration are enabling manufacturers to offer smart, automated valves for critical infrastructure. As German industries continue to modernize, the adoption of hybrid valves is poised to accelerate, underpinned by the presence of major players like Emerson Electric Co., Kitz Corporation, and Christian Bürkert GmbH & Co. Germany Hybrid Valve Market Share (%) by Type, 2025
In 2025, rotary valves dominate the Germany Hybrid Valve Market, accounting for 30% of the total market share. Ball valves follow with 25%, while butterfly valves capture 20%. The remaining market is divided among globe valves (12%), plug valves (8%), and other types (5%). The growing preference for rotary and ball valves stems from their operational efficiency, versatility, and suitability for automated process control environments. As industries continue to demand valves with superior leakage prevention and lower maintenance, these types are increasingly favored. The consistent demand for butterfly and globe valves is driven by specialized applications within energy, chemicals, and water sectors.
Germany Hybrid Valve Market Share (%) by Applications, 2025
The oil & gas sector leads hybrid valve adoption in Germany, representing 28% of the market in 2025. Water & wastewater applications hold 22%, followed by the energy & power sector at 18%. The food & beverage (12%), chemicals (10%), pharmaceuticals (7%), and other applications (3%) make up the remainder. This distribution reflects the critical role of hybrid valves in sectors needing efficient and reliable flow control, especially under severe operating conditions. With Germany investing heavily in water management and sustainable energy, hybrid valve demand is projected to rise significantly in related industries over the coming decade.

Germany Hybrid Valve Market Share (%) by Regions, 2025
In 2025, North Rhine-Westphalia accounts for 32% of the German hybrid valve market, benefiting from its concentration of manufacturing and energy industries. Bavaria follows with a 25% share, while Baden-Württemberg contributes 20%. The remaining share is distributed among other regions including Lower Saxony and Hesse. Regional dominance is attributed to the prevalence of process industries, large-scale energy projects, and extensive water infrastructure networks. As industrial modernization accelerates across Germany, the market share is expected to become more evenly distributed, with emerging growth in eastern states.
